Abstract
A game of skill in which an elongated balloon is pressed into a mounted cylindrical launching tube, against a projection in the launching tube, and released permitting the balloon to fly out of the tube on a trajectory determined by the postion of the tube. The balloon is encircled by an elasitc band or ring prior to launching, and the encircling ring is ejected by the balloon at the point of impact. The complete game may include the launching tube and mount, an elongated balloon and encircling elastic ring together with one or more targets to be encircled by the ring.

2 Claims, 6 Drawing Figures BALLOON LAUNCHING APPARATUS WITH TARGET INDICATING RING S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ION This invention relates to a game of skill in which an inflated balloon is launched from a mounted tube to hit a specific target. An encircling ring on the launched balloon is dropped by the balloon at the point of impact so as to encircle the target.
The launching device is a hollow cylindrical tube which is mounted so that the longitudinal axis of the tube is pivotable in a vertical plane. The base which holds the tube may be rotated in the horizontal plane to also aim the launching tube. A projection in the tube, preferably a round rod mounted to the bottom of the tube and projecting along the longitudinal axis of the launching tube, serves to compress an elongated balloon that is manually pushed into the tube from the tube mouth. An elastic encircling band is placed about the nose of the inflated balloon prior to the release of the balloon. Manual release of the compressed balloon serves to eject it into the air on a trajectory determined by the position of the launching tube and the'location of the weight of the encircling ring. Upon impact, the encircling ring is released, with the balloon bounding away from the target. The target may be a two or three dimensional form to be encircled by the ring, or the target may be in the form of an open hoop, with various points awarded to the player whose balloon or ring, or both go through the hoop I BRIEF DESCRIPTION OF THE DRAWING The objects and features of the invention may be understoodwith reference' to the following detailed description of an illustrative embodiment of the invention, taken together with the'accompanying drawing in which:

A dowel pin 15, fastened along the longitudinal axis of launch tube 12, is fixed to the inside bottom 24 of the launch tube.
As shown in FIG. 3 and FIG. 4, an inflated elongated balloon 20 and an elastic ring 21 are assembled together, with the ring located as desired around the periphery of the balloon 20 in the general location of the nose 23 of the balloon. For accurate repetition of trajectories, the-inflated balloon diameter A should be of the order of the inner diameter B of the tube 12.
The inflated balloon 20 assembled with the elastic ring 21 is pressed into the launch tube 12, as shown in FIG. 5 against the dowel pin 15 by a hand 19, and then released with the balloon and ring flying to the target. Upon impact, the ring is released with the balloon rebounding from'the point of initial impact.

A game of skill, in which an inflated balloon is ejected on a trajectory towards a target from a launching tube, with the balloon marking the general area of impact when it strikes an object, consisting of a hollow launching tube, rotatable joint means mounting the tube to a base so as to permit the longitudinal axis of the launch tube to rotate in the vertical plane when the base is resting on a horizontal surface, means to fix the said rotatable joint in one position, a circular member inside of said launch tube that acts to compress an inflated balloon which is pressed into said launch tube, and an inflated balloon which may be manually compressed against said circular member in the launch tube and then released, said balloon when released being ejected in a trajectory based on the angular setting of the launch tube axis with regard to the frame of the device, and an elastic ring which is fastened over the nose section of the inflated balloon prior to its release out of the launch tube, said elastic ring serving to mark the impact area struck by the ejected balloon, by the ring being ejected from the balloon when the balloon makes impact with a target.
2. The combination recited in claim 1 together with a target which is of lesser diameter than the diameter of the elastic ring so that an assembled balloon and ring ejects the ring about the target when said balloon impacts the target.
